After just buying a uke is there a way of making this and or leaving on a jet plane on the most simple of chords? If that makes sense.
Hey Cody - yes absolutely. So these are the basic "easy" chords on ukulele, especially for beginners getting started. The G chord, a 3 finger chord, is definitely the most challenging though! Songs that are in the key of C, like this one, are best for beginners. I do also have a tutorial of Leaving on a Jet Plane in the key of C. I'll post a link below. Hope this helps!!
